A motorcyclist has been hospitalised with serious injuries following a collision with a car near a village in Ayrshire.

The rider was unseated from his bike during the crash shortly after 5pm on the B730 just outside Tarbolton on Wednesday, June 15.

The driver of the car was unhurt in the incident and stopped afterwards, however the motorcyclist was transferred to Queen Elizabeth University Hospital in Glasgow for treatment.

Officers say the driver has now been reported to the procurator fiscal for road traffic offences.

A spokesperson for Police Scotland added: “Officers were called to a road crash involving a motorcycle and a car on a road close to the village of Tarbolton, Ayrshire on Wednesday, June 15.

“Emergency services were in attendance and the motorcyclist was conveyed to the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ital with serious injuries.

“The driver of the car was unhurt and will be reported for road traffic offences.”
